Controlled burns produce heavy smoke near greenwich roadSedgwick County KS

Greenwich Rd & E 103rd St S, Rockford Township, KS 67110

There are two controlled burns producing heavy black smoke near Greenwich Road and nearby railroad tracks in Rockford Township.
